AI News Roundup: Datacenters, Governance and Health Breakthroughs

AI news keeps accelerating, weaving through politics, business, health, and policy. Datacenters sit at the center of debates as communities weigh the benefits of robust AI infrastructure against local concerns. A recent poll indicated that roughly three-quarters of Americans oppose datacenters built next to their homes, a signal that the physical backbone of AI is as political as it is technical. Against this backdrop, Donald Trump criticized communities resisting datacenter projects, warning that those who say no risk becoming backward and poor. As midterm campaigns frame tech policy through jobs, energy, and zoning, the friction between local decisions and national AI ambitions shapes everything from local taxes to the speed of cloud services. This is not only a story about hardware; it is about a data-driven world the public will live in, affecting energy bills, privacy expectations, and the reliability of online services that power work and play.

In the enterprise, AI is moving from demonstrations to integrated workflows. Workday is rethinking how AI agents should function inside everyday operations, recognizing that real gains come when AI acts as a trusted partner across hiring, finance, and operations, not merely as a chatbot. At the same time, governance strategies are maturing. Box has published guidance on how to constrain AI agent behavior within corporate systems, proposing three action tiers: fully autonomous actions that are bounded and reversible, monitored actions with rollback, and high-risk actions that require human approval. By embedding governance into the platform and using metadata, data classification, and risk-aware execution, organizations can accelerate AI adoption while preserving security. The goal is to empower teams to experiment quickly yet trace, audit, and roll back if needed.

Energy and climate considerations are a recurring thread. Several observers argue that datacenters should generate their own electricity and tighten emissions through solar roofing, wind, storage, and scrubbers. In the United Kingdom, analyses have highlighted datacenters that could demand electricity on a scale comparable to entire nations if not designed with ambition, underscoring the need for smarter, location-aware energy strategy. The broader message is clear: reimagine datacenters as energy-aware nodes in a green AI network that can support scale without overburdening local grids.

Health AI is delivering breakthroughs alongside new cautions. A model trained on millions of ECGs demonstrates the potential to spot heart disease in under two seconds, offering the potential to speed up treatment for high-risk patients. But as AI moves into clinical workflows, other tools such as AI scribes that transcribe patient conversations have raised alarms about accuracy, sometimes mislabeling drugs or diagnoses. The contrast points to a simple truth: speed and scale must be matched by rigorous validation, governance, and ongoing human oversight when AI touches patient care. The promise remains compelling, and the path to safe, beneficial use is becoming clearer through standards and audits that institutions are starting to adopt.

Beyond products and patients, governance and policy are shifting. Many voices argue that identity and permissions alone cannot fully govern AI agents, which operate across unstructured content and rapidly changing toolsets. A layered approach that blends access controls with controlled execution and tiered approvals is gaining traction as a practical path forward.
